Terraform provides a data source that allows us to read available information from our AWS account, computed for use elsewhere in Terraform configuration, We retrieve information about our default VPC and Subnets below. Amazon Elastic Container Service (Amazon ECS) is a scalable, high-performance container orchestration service that supports Docker containers and allows you to easily run and scale containerized applications on AWS. AWS Fargate is a technology that you can use with AWS Batch to run containers without having to manage servers or clusters of Amazon EC2 instances.
